What Are Measurement Methods?

What Are Measurement Methods? Measurement methods identify how data will be gathered to measure project progress. They are an important component of a project logframe. Measurement methods are divided into two categories: quantitative and qualitative. … Examples of qualitative methods include case studies, interviews and focus groups.
